Combination eMachine Shop part views and dimensions for single or multi-plate Etek and reduction housing.

Two Eteks are bolted to the Main Plate at each end with a chain from each driving one of the rear wheels, axles exiting between the motors. A second set of Eteks are mounted to an opposing plate and the facing motors are coupled. A Center Plate may be required at the half shaft to support the inner bearing and it would be advantageous to somehow clutch these large sprockets.
